Midnight

I love collecting treasure in the middle of the night
Fireflies mark the spot
But beware....

Gameplay Controls
Arrow keys to walk
Z to dig

other
R to restart
F increase/decrease window size
Spacebar to skip title screen

Tools used
Gamemaker Studio
BFXR

Known issue(s)
Some objects appear in front of the walls instead of behind them.

This is my first time entering LD48 and the first time I created a game in such a short time. I tried to use some techniques that I hadn't used before. So that took some extra time, but I think it worked out pretty good. At least I was able to create what I had in mind. The code is a bit of a mess but hey who cares ;)
